The unity of physics: the beauty and power of spectroscopy — •Paul Julienne — Joint Quantum Institute, NIST and the University of Maryland, College Park, Maryland, USA

Physics exhibits a deep unity across all its disciplines. This is nowhere so evident as in the power of spectroscopy, the highly specific frequency-dependent interaction of light with matter, to inform us about a wide range of phenomena. We rightly honor Professor Eberhard Tiemann for his beautiful applications of molecular spectroscopy to essential science needed for ultracold matter studies that have come to span many areas of physics. His work on molecular potentials has enabled highly predictive models to be developed for the interactions of many magnetically and optically controllable ultracold atoms. Precise knowledge of these interactions has been a key to the success of the multidisciplinary reach of experiments involving cold atoms and molecules. I will illustrate this for two cases related to ultracold chemistry: the production of cold ground state molecules and the understanding of product distributions in three-body recombination of cold atoms.
